Linda Hastings Tax Implications of Discounted Notes
27 April 2021 | 7 replies
1)  Accrued ratably means to multiply the total discount by the following fraction:(A) the number of days you hold the note, divided by(B) the number of days after the date you acquire the note and up to (and including) the date of its maturity.You take this amortized amount as ordinary income when you sell the note or you can elect to take a piece into income each year.
